Output 7ecb62f34f02539d986c8e324406e9cc9d68dc12e00bb5bc5ca55a12ffbe2ffe:1

value
66207627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773343587d4d4fc173049085dbffc03b6717d5d6 OP_EQUAL
address
MJmS45WGukGhH72LE8HGTNq3Vh9jFU1ZK2
transaction
7ecb62f34f02539d986c8e324406e9cc9d68dc12e00bb5bc5ca55a12ffbe2ffe
spent
true